Question

Which one is the Mechanical Measures of erosion control ?

The correct answer is
Sub-soiling

Mechanical Measures for Erosion Control Identified

Erosion control involves managing soil loss caused by wind or water. Measures are often categorized as mechanical (physical interventions) or vegetative/biological (using plants and organic matter).

Analyzing Erosion Control Measures

The question asks for a mechanical measure of erosion control. Let's examine the options:

  • Sub-soiling: This is a tillage process where a specialized plow (sub-soiler) breaks up compacted soil layers deep below the surface without bringing the lower soil to the top. This improves water infiltration and root penetration. It is a direct physical alteration of the soil structure.
  • Mixed cropping: This involves growing two or more crops together in the same field. It's primarily a biological and agronomic practice aimed at diversifying yield and managing pests, not a direct mechanical intervention for erosion control.
  • Strip cropping: This practice involves planting different types of crops in alternating strips. While the layout involves planning, the primary erosion control comes from the different crop types and their arrangement slowing water runoff and trapping sediment. It's considered a conservation cropping system rather than a purely mechanical measure like altering soil structure.
  • Mulching: This involves covering the soil surface with organic material (like straw or wood chips) or inorganic materials. It protects the soil from raindrop impact and reduces runoff velocity. This is a cultural or biological practice, not a mechanical one.

Conclusion on Mechanical Measure

Comparing the options, Sub-soiling directly addresses soil structure physically to manage water movement and thus control erosion. The other options are primarily cropping systems or surface management techniques.

Therefore, Sub-soiling is the correct mechanical measure of erosion control among the choices.
